Why Hasn’t Crypto Become a Common Day to Day Currency Yet?
I've been following crypto for a while, but it still feels like there are major barriers to everyday cryptocurrency payments. Between volatility and pricing concerns, payment speed and fees, and the overall crypto wallet usability experience, paying with crypto often feels less convenient than traditional options.
On top of that merchant adoption is still limited, and regulatory compliance requirements can make onboarding and spending more complicated than it needs to be. It seems like improving the user experience for daily spending and creating simpler, compliant access points could go a long way toward making crypto more practical.
